Looking for GED® testing in Rollins MT? The GED® test is only given in person and not online. Typically to be able to take the exam the test taker must be over 17 years old. The examination fee in the state of Montana typically ranges from $40 to $90.
The GED® examination consists of five tests: language arts (reading), language arts (writing), mathematics, science and social studies. Each test gives a score between 200-800. Many states require students to receive a score of 410 on each of the five tests and an overall average of 450 for the exam to pass.
